网站常用的加密方式包括以下4种:1、SSL/TLS,通过为客户端和服务器之间的通信建立安全的加密连接,确保传输的数据在网络上是加密的,并防止被未经授权的人恶意获取;2、HTTPS,在 HTTP 协议上添加了 SSL/TLS 加密协议的扩展;3、AES,是一种对称加密算法,广泛应用于数据的加密和解密过程中;4、RSA ,一种非对称加密算法,用于数据的加密、解密和数字签名。
本教程操作系统:Windows10系统、Dell G3电脑。
网站常用的加密方式包括以下几种:
SSL/TLS:
SSL(Secure Sockets Layer)和其继任者 TLS(Transport Layer Security)是最常见的加密协议。它们通过为客户端和服务器之间的通信建立安全的加密连接,确保传输的数据在网络上是加密的,并防止被未经授权的人恶意获取。工作原理是通过使用对称加密和非对称加密相结合的方式,实现通信数据的加密和身份验证。
HTTPS:
HTTPS(Hypertext Transfer Protocol Secure)是在 HTTP 协议上添加了 SSL/TLS 加密协议的扩展,用于保护 Web 浏览器和服务器之间的通信。通过使用 SSL/TLS 加密协议,HTTPS 可以确保传输的数据在传输过程中是安全的,防止窃听和篡改。
AES(Advanced Encryption Standard):
AES 是一种对称加密算法,广泛应用于数据的加密和解密过程中。AES 使用相同的密钥来加密和解密数据,其安全性依赖于密钥的保密性。AES 算法采用分组加密的方式,将明文数据分成固定长度的数据块,然后对每个数据块进行加密。
RSA:
RSA 是一种非对称加密算法,用于数据的加密、解密和数字签名。它基于两个大素数的乘积难以分解的特性,其中一个素数用于生成公钥,另一个用于生成私钥。RSA 加密过程是用公钥加密数据,然后用私钥进行解密。
这些加密方式的工作原理主要涉及使用不同的加密算法和密钥来对数据进行加密和解密。对称加密使用相同的密钥进行加密和解密,而非对称加密使用公钥和私钥进行加密和解密。安全的加密工作需要保证密钥的安全性和正确的实施加密算法。
以上是网站加密方式是什么的详细内容。更多信息请关注PHP中文网其他相关文章!
if($res){
return json_encode(array('code'=>1,'msg'=>'成功'));
}else{
return json_encode(array('code'=>0,'msg'=>'失败'));
}
}
public function
}
if($res){
return json_encode(array('code'=>1,'msg'=>'成功'));
}else{
return json_encode(array('code'=>0,'msg'=>'失败'));
}
}
public function
}
if($res){
return json_encode(array('code'=>1,'msg'=>'成功'));
}else{
return json_encode(array('code'=>0,'msg'=>'失败'));
}
}
public function
}